Fun fact, were you aware that buildings can shift depending on temperatures outdoors? This might remind you of middle school science classes, but heat will cause most materials to expand while the cold will cause them to contract. As a result, many architects and engineers often have to make sure that control joints are made up of the right materials and in good condition. About The Area
300 Broad Street is located in Fairfield County, Connecticut. There are 941,618 people living here. There are 335,209 households. Most of these households have an average family size of 3.3 people. According to the census, 32% are currently renting while 68% own their homes. The median age of this population is around 39.9 years old. On average, most folks in the county are married. About 29% of folks speak a language other than English in this area. The area's employment rate is currently around 62.7%. Speaking of employment, the median income is $86,670. Most folks will commute by car for around 29.7 minutes. Finally, we know that 22% of residents in the area have graduated with their high school degree. Additionally, 26% and 20% have their Bachelor's and Master's degree, respectfully.

Moving on to the urban area level. Bridgeport - Stamford, CT - NY Urban Area has a population of 945,153 people. Based on census records, there are 339,164 registered households. Families in this area are on average made up of 3.31 people per household. Most folks are married. They are also typically around 40.1 years old. Does diversity matter to you? Right now, 29% of folks speak a language other than English here. About 33% rent while 67% purchased their homes. Right now, the community is made up of 23% of residents who have graduated with at least a high school degree. On top of that, 25% have a Bachelor's degree and 20% have a Master's degree. The employment rate is currently around 62.1%. Those employed, have a median income of $83,284.
